Core Concept Explanation
Custom chips are specialized semiconductor devices tailored for specific applications rather than general use. Unlike traditional, one-size-fits-all processors, custom chips are engineered to optimize particular functions, such as processing speed, energy efficiency, or data handling capacity. This specificity allows companies to achieve superior performance in their products, making them highly appealing in tech-driven markets.
The relevance of custom chips is underscored by the increasing demand for devices that can efficiently perform complex computations, such as those used in machine learning or high-resolution graphics rendering. As more industries, like automotive and healthcare, integrate advanced technologies, the demand for these specialized chips continues to rise.

Risks and Considerations
Despite the potential benefits, investing in the custom chip sector carries certain risks. The high cost of research and development can strain financial resources, particularly for smaller companies. Additionally, the rapid pace of technological change may render certain designs obsolete faster than anticipated.
Investors should conduct thorough research and consider a company's long-term vision and adaptability to technological shifts. Diversification remains a critical component of risk management, helping to buffer against sector-specific volatility.
